summaryrefslogtreecommitdiff
path: root/IntelFrameworkModulePkg/Csm
diff options
context:
space:
mode:
authorStar Zeng <star.zeng@intel.com>2016-12-16 18:07:12 +0800
committerStar Zeng <star.zeng@intel.com>2016-12-26 18:17:00 +0800
commit7863d11c0092bbe6507c8bebbde6cb5784184657 (patch)
tree832d38eaecf9485b82d185a4f1eba82def7b2d6e /IntelFrameworkModulePkg/Csm
parent35dadd7c54ef12c87672c5eea35a75fa545ce68e (diff)
downloadedk2-7863d11c0092bbe6507c8bebbde6cb5784184657.zip
edk2-7863d11c0092bbe6507c8bebbde6cb5784184657.tar.gz
edk2-7863d11c0092bbe6507c8bebbde6cb5784184657.tar.bz2
IntelFrameworkModulePkg Ps2KbDxe: Execute key notify func at TPL_CALLBACK
Current implementation executes key notify function in TimerHandler at TPL_NOTIFY. The code change is to make key notify function executed at TPL_CALLBACK to reduce the time occupied at TPL_NOTIFY. The code will signal KeyNotify process event if the key pressed matches any key registered and insert the KeyData to the EFI Key queue for notify, then the KeyNotify process handler will invoke key notify functions at TPL_CALLBACK. Cc: Ruiyu Ni <Ruiyu.ni@intel.com> Cc: Michael Kinney <michael.d.kinney@intel.com> Cc: Feng Tian <feng.tian@intel.com> Cc: Jeff Fan <jeff.fan@intel.com> Contributed-under: TianoCore Contribution Agreement 1.0 Signed-off-by: Star Zeng <star.zeng@intel.com> Reviewed-by: Jeff Fan <jeff.fan@intel.com> Reviewed-by: Ruiyu Ni <Ruiyu.ni@intel.com>
Diffstat (limited to 'IntelFrameworkModulePkg/Csm')
0 files changed, 0 insertions, 0 deletions